Description

Summary: 1 cuboid fragment, about 20 mm on all sides, of calcified or silicified wood, similar in appearance to specimens from the Wealden Beds (ENDOGENITES), from a small field known as Oliver's Hill Field, Cherhill, Wiltshire, excavated by I F Smith and J G Evans, on behalf of WANHS, 1967.
